The 65-year-old, who died in the Cardiff Hilton last week, was suffering from hardening of the arteries, according to his death certificate. Written by Dimitri Tiomkin and Ned Washington, the song won a Golden Globe Award and was nominated for an Academy Award for Best Song, but lost to "Moon River". In 1966, Gene Pitney married his childhood sweetheart, Lynne Gayton, and the couple had three sons together, Todd, Chris, and David. He had nine dates left on his 23-date UK tour and was due to appear at Bristol's Colston Hall on Wednesday. After a long break, he made his comeback with a duet version of Something's Gotten Hold of My Heart with singer Marc Almond; it reached and stayed at No.1 in UK for four weeks in January 1989, and gained the No.1 ranking in Germany, Switzerland, Finland, and Ireland. Gene's first foray into the music scene was as part of a duet with Ginny Arnell, their first song being 1959's "Classical Rock & Roll.
